      "message": "kbuild: check license compatibility when building modules\n\nModules that uses GPL symbols can no longer be build with kbuild,\nthe build will fail during the modpost step.\nWhen a GPL-incompatible module uses a E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L_FUTURE symbol\nthen warn during modpost so author are actually notified.\n\nThe actual license compatibility check is shared with the kernel\nto make sure it is in sync.\n\nPatch originally from: Andreas Gruenbacher \u003cagruen@suse.de\u003e and\nRam Pai \u003clinuxram@us.ibm.com\u003e\n\nSigned-off-by: Sam Ravnborg \u003csam@ravnborg.org\u003e\n"
